Word Does Not Find Text Plus Field Results

The information in this article applies to:

  • Microsoft Word for Windows, versions 6.0, 6.0a

SYMPTOMS

When you use the Find or Replace command (on the Edit menu), Word for Windows does not find the search string if the string contains both field code results and plain text.

Word finds field results, and Word finds plain text, but Word cannot find a combination of the two.

STATUS

Microsoft has confirmed this to be a problem in Word versions 6.0 and 6.0a for Windows. We are researching this problem and will post new information here in the Microsoft Knowledge Base as it becomes available.
